Common Causes of Jeep Wrangler Radiator Fan Failure
The radiator fan in a Jeep Wrangler plays a crucial role in maintaining optimal engine temperature by facilitating the cooling process. When the radiator fan fails to operate, it can lead to overheating, which may cause significant engine damage if not addressed promptly. Understanding the common causes of radiator fan failure is essential for Jeep owners to diagnose and resolve issues effectively.
One of the primary reasons for radiator fan malfunction is a blown fuse. The electrical system in a Jeep Wrangler is designed with various fuses that protect components from excessive current. If the fuse associated with the radiator fan blows, the fan will cease to function. Checking the fuse box for any blown fuses is a straightforward first step in troubleshooting the issue. If a blown fuse is found, replacing it may restore the fan’s operation, but it is also important to investigate the underlying cause of the failure to prevent recurrence.
Another common cause of radiator fan failure is a faulty relay. The relay acts as a switch that controls the power supply to the fan. If the relay becomes defective, it may not send the necessary signal to activate the fan, resulting in a non-functional cooling system. Testing the relay with a multimeter can help determine if it is working correctly. If the relay is found to be faulty, replacing it is typically a simple and cost-effective solution.
In addition to electrical issues, mechanical problems can also lead to radiator fan failure. Over time, the fan motor may wear out or become damaged due to exposure to heat and debris. A worn-out motor may struggle to turn the fan blades, leading to inadequate airflow and cooling. In such cases, replacing the fan motor is necessary to restore proper function. Furthermore, physical obstructions, such as dirt, leaves, or other debris, can impede the fan’s movement. Regular maintenance, including cleaning the fan and surrounding areas, can help prevent such blockages.
Thermostat issues can also contribute to radiator fan failure. The thermostat regulates the engine’s temperature by controlling the flow of coolant. If the thermostat is stuck in the closed position, it can cause the engine to overheat, which may prevent the fan from engaging as it should. Conversely, if the thermostat is stuck open, the engine may not reach the optimal temperature, leading to erratic fan operation. Diagnosing and replacing a faulty thermostat can help ensure that the cooling system operates efficiently.
Additionally, wiring problems can lead to radiator fan failure. Corroded, frayed, or damaged wires can disrupt the electrical flow necessary for the fan to operate. Inspecting the wiring harness for any signs of wear or damage is essential. If any issues are found, repairing or replacing the affected wiring can restore functionality to the radiator fan.
Lastly, the engine control unit (ECU) plays a vital role in regulating the radiator fan’s operation. If the ECU malfunctions or fails to send the correct signals, the fan may not operate as intended. Diagnosing ECU issues typically requires specialized equipment and expertise, making it advisable to consult a professional mechanic if this is suspected.

How to Diagnose a Non-Working Radiator Fan in a Jeep Wrangler
Diagnosing a non-working radiator fan in a Jeep Wrangler is a critical task that requires a systematic approach to ensure the vehicle operates efficiently and avoids overheating. The radiator fan plays a vital role in maintaining optimal engine temperatures by drawing air through the radiator, especially during idling or low-speed driving. When the fan fails to operate, it can lead to severe engine damage, making it essential to identify the issue promptly.
To begin the diagnostic process, it is important to check the basics. Start by inspecting the vehicle’s fuse box for any blown fuses related to the cooling system. A blown fuse can interrupt the power supply to the radiator fan, preventing it from functioning. If the fuse appears intact, the next step is to examine the fan relay. The relay acts as a switch that controls the power to the fan; if it is faulty, it may not send the necessary signal to activate the fan. Testing the relay with a multimeter can help determine if it is functioning correctly.
Once the electrical components have been assessed, the next area to investigate is the wiring. Look for any signs of damage, such as frayed wires or loose connections, which could impede the electrical flow to the fan. It is crucial to ensure that all connections are secure and free from corrosion. If the wiring appears intact, the next logical step is to test the fan motor itself. This can be done by applying direct power to the fan; if it operates, the issue lies within the electrical system rather than the fan motor. Conversely, if the fan does not respond, it may need to be replaced.
In addition to these electrical checks, it is also important to consider the temperature sensor. The temperature sensor monitors the engine’s temperature and signals the radiator fan to activate when necessary. If the sensor is malfunctioning, it may not trigger the fan, leading to overheating. Testing the sensor with a multimeter can help determine its functionality. If the sensor is found to be defective, replacing it may resolve the issue.
Furthermore, it is advisable to inspect the coolant levels in the radiator. Low coolant levels can cause the engine to overheat, which may lead to the fan running continuously or not at all. Ensuring that the coolant is at the appropriate level and that there are no leaks in the system is essential for proper engine cooling. If the coolant levels are adequate, but the engine continues to overheat, it may indicate a more serious issue, such as a clogged radiator or a malfunctioning thermostat.

Step-by-Step Guide to Replace a Jeep Wrangler Radiator Fan
When faced with the issue of a non-functioning radiator fan in a Jeep Wrangler, it is essential to address the problem promptly to prevent overheating and potential engine damage. Replacing the radiator fan is a manageable task that can be accomplished with some basic tools and a methodical approach. This step-by-step guide will walk you through the process, ensuring that you can restore your vehicle’s cooling system effectively.
To begin, gather the necessary tools and materials. You will need a socket set, a wrench, a screwdriver, and, of course, a replacement radiator fan compatible with your Jeep Wrangler model. Before starting the replacement process, ensure that the vehicle is parked on a level surface and the engine is completely cool. This precaution is vital for your safety, as working on a hot engine can lead to burns or other injuries.
Once you have prepared your workspace, the next step is to disconnect the battery. This action is crucial to prevent any electrical shorts or accidental activation of the fan while you are working on it. After disconnecting the battery, locate the radiator fan assembly. In most Jeep Wrangler models, the fan is situated in front of the radiator, making it relatively accessible.
With the fan assembly in sight, you will need to remove any components obstructing access to the fan. This may include the air intake duct or other nearby parts. Use your screwdriver and socket set to carefully detach these components, taking care to keep track of any screws or clips for reassembly later. Once you have cleared the area, you can proceed to disconnect the electrical connector from the fan. Gently pull the connector apart, ensuring that you do not damage any wiring in the process.
Now that the electrical connection is removed, you can focus on unbolting the radiator fan from its mounting points. Typically, the fan is secured with several bolts that can be accessed from the front of the radiator. Using your socket set, remove these bolts one by one, placing them in a safe location to avoid losing them. As you remove the fan, be cautious of any remaining wiring or hoses that may still be attached.
After successfully detaching the old fan, it is time to install the new radiator fan. Begin by positioning the new fan in the same orientation as the old one, aligning it with the mounting points. Secure the fan in place by tightening the bolts you previously removed. It is important to ensure that the fan is firmly attached to prevent any vibrations or movement while the engine is running.
Once the new fan is securely in place, reconnect the electrical connector, ensuring that it clicks into position. Following this, reassemble any components you had previously removed, such as the air intake duct, making sure that all screws and clips are properly fastened. Finally, reconnect the battery, ensuring that the terminals are secure.
To complete the process, start the engine and allow it to reach operating temperature. Observe the new radiator fan to confirm that it is functioning correctly. If the fan activates as expected, you have successfully replaced the radiator fan in your Jeep Wrangler.
